Executive Mosaic’s GovCon Index ends 0.35% higher at $5,361.04 for its highest close following ten straight positive finishes. Wall Street was all green on broad-based gains. The Dow Jones Industrial Average (+0.58%) and S&P 500 (+0.97%) kept their winning streaks going, and so did the Nasdaq Composite (+1.39%) besides climbing out of correction territory.

All 11 S&P 500 primary sectors and 78% of NYSE stocks advanced Monday. Advanced Micro Devices (Nasdaq: AMD) rose 4.52% to lead the rally on the tech side. The semiconductor firm announced plans to acquire server builder ZT Systems and boost its artificial intelligence, or AI, ecosystem. Tinder operator Match Group (Nasdaq: MTCH) fell 3.95% after announcing a workforce reduction. 

The GovCon Index had 22 gainers to start the week. KBR (NYSE: KBR), along with six other stocks, rose more than 1%, while Northrop Grumman (NYSE: NOC) led eigth decliners.     

KBR confirmed obtaining a cost-plus-fixed-fee contract with the U.S. Navy. The Space Science Instruments and Experimental Payloads 3 contract is for the continued development of space science instrument systems at the Naval Research Lab in Washington, D.C.

Accenture (NYSE: ACN), through Accenture Ventures, made a strategic investment in biotech firm Earli Inc. The investment supports expanding collaborations with global health and pharma companies that can use Earli’s technology for early cancer detection.

The U.S. Air Force awarded Science Applications International Corp. (Nasdaq: SAIC) a maximum $262.4 million contract bridge modification to the previously awarded Government Wide Acquisition Contract Alliant 2 vehicle for continued Air Force cloud computing capability.

Also on Aug. 19, the U.S. Navy awarded Fluor Marine Propulsion, a Fluor Corporation (NYSE: FLR) special purpose entity, a $1.39 billion cost-plus-fixed-fee modification to a previously awarded contract to exercise fiscal 2025 options for naval nuclear propulsion work at the Naval Nuclear Laboratory. 

The earnings season is almost over, with only 7% of S&P 500 companies remaining to present their second-quarter results. Meanwhile, Federal Reserve Chairman Jerome Powell’s appearance at Thursday’s annual monetary policy symposium in Jackson Hole, Wyoming, is this week’s highlight. He will provide an economic outlook and maybe the timing of an impending rate action. A Reuters poll predicts three cuts beginning in September.
